V35.2XXDBillable
Person on outside of three-wheeled motor vehicle injured in collision with railway train or railway vehicle in nontraffic accident, subsequent encounter
Short description: Prsn outsd 3-whl mv inj in clsn w rail trn/veh nontraf, subs

Frequently asked questions
What is ICD-10 code V35.2XXD?
V35.2XXD is an ICD-10-CM diagnosis code for Person on outside of three-wheeled motor vehicle injured in collision with railway train or railway vehicle in nontraffic accident, subsequent encounter.
Is V35.2XXD a billable code?
Yes. V35.2XXD is billable and specific enough to be used on a claim.
What ICD-10-CM chapter is V35.2XXD in?
V35.2XXD falls under Chapter 20: External causes of morbidity.
When did V35.2XXD become effective?
V35.2XXD has been effective since October 1, 2026, per the CMS/CDC ICD-10-CM annual release.
